What the complete compressed-air package must solve

01 · Demand

Map the working air profile

For manufacturing in Centurion, list the equipment behind pneumatic tools, actuators, fixtures, cleaning and machine automation and separate steady consumers from short peaks. This determines whether 15 kW is a base-load match or only one part of the final system.

03 · Control

Choose fixed-speed or VSD from data

Where technology demand changes through the shift, VSD may reduce unloaded operation. Where demand is stable, fixed-speed can remain the better-value option. Before we price the machine

Five questions for the Centurion quotation

  1. How will hot discharge air leave the compressor room?
  2. Is production able to stop for planned maintenance, or is redundancy required?
  3. What future machines or production lines are likely to be added?
  4. How far is the compressor room from the largest air users?
  5. Will the equipment need off-loading, positioning and commissioning as part of the quote?

Local service planning

15 kW air compressor service and repairs for Centurion

At a Centurion site, reliability depends on the compressor, cooling, storage, treatment and distribution working together. For a 15 kW unit, record temperature, pressure, current, separator condition and air treatment.

Planned service

Maintenance prepared by model and hours

Oil, filters, separator, drive, cooling, drains and controls are scoped from the exact machine.

Breakdown support

Evidence before parts replacement

Alarms, pressure, temperature, current and behaviour help separate component, demand, ventilation and pipework faults in Centurion.
